My outdoor outlet stopped working after a cold snap. Can you help?
Absolutely. Outdoor outlet failures due to freeze damage are a common issue we see in the Sterling area. Moisture can seep in, freeze, and crack the housing or damage internal components, creating a safety hazard. Our technicians can safely diagnose the problem, repair or replace the damaged outlet with a weather-resistant model rated for our climate, and ensure the wiring is protected to prevent future issues, restoring safe power to your outdoor spaces.
